An expert locksmith can provide a variety of services to help you with your car keys. Here are some of the most common services:
Key Duplication: This service involves developing a precise copy of your existing car key. It's straightforward for traditional metal keys but can be more complex for keys with electronic parts.Key Programming: Many modern-day cars and trucks have transponder keys that require to be programmed to the vehicle's computer system. A locksmith can program a brand-new key to ensure it works perfectly with your car.Key Extraction: If your key breaks off in the lock, a locksmith can safely remove it without causing damage to the lock or the vehicle.Lock Repair and Replacement: If your car lock is damaged or malfunctioning, a locksmith can repair or replace it, ensuring that your vehicle remains protected.Emergency Situation Lockout Assistance: In the occasion that you are locked out of your car, a locksmith can provide fast and efficient help to get you back in.Tips for Choosing the Right LocksmithInspect Credentials: Verify that the locksmith is licensed and certified. Q: How much does a locksmith normally charge for car key services?A: The expense can vary depending on the service and the locksmith. Key duplication for a traditional metal key can cost between ₤ 10 and ₤ 50, while programming a transponder key can vary from ₤ 50 to ₤ 150. Emergency services may be more costly, however lots of locksmith professionals use flat rates or discounts.
Q: Can a locksmith replace a lost key fob?A: Yes, a professional locksmith can replace a lost key fob. They can program a new fob to deal with your vehicle's system, frequently at a lower expense than a dealer.
Q: What should I do if my key breaks in the lock?A: If your key breaks in the lock, do not try to require it out. Call a locksmith who can safely extract the broken piece and develop a new key for you.
Q: Are locksmith professionals readily available 24/7?A: Many locksmiths provide 24/7 emergency situation services. It's a good concept to inquire about their schedule when you contact them.
Q: How long does it consider a locksmith to get here?A: The arrival time can differ depending on the locksmith's schedule and your area. A lot of locksmiths intend to get here within 30 minutes to an hour.
Q: Can a locksmith assist with keyless entry systems?A: Yes, a locksmith can aid with keyless entry systems. They can diagnose issues, replace batteries, and reprogram the system if needed.
